Transaction 74064939afa8388a04cf2853460ddfc8e5fca35770cb8dd11a979a8320ac6695
1 Input
1 Output
-
74064939afa8388a04cf2853460ddfc8e5fca35770cb8dd11a979a8320ac6695:0
- value
- 12850
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85bbe76fc5d1ef8b1127d4f0b4612b0438cafc7a33209ca3eb4e142219fdea87
- address
- tb1pska7wm7968hckyf86nctgcftqsuv4lr6xvsfegltfc2zyx0aa2rsr6fg5s